Facebook parent Meta to cut almost 11,000 staff in 2022's largest US layoffs

Meta Platforms Inc META.O announced on Wednesday that it will lay off 13% of its workforce, or more than 11,000 workers, in one of the year’s largest layoffs, as the Facebook parent company confronts rising costs and a sluggish advertising market. The large layoffs, the first in Meta’s 18-year history, come after hundreds of layoffs at other prominent digital companies, …
